From 1c3c94a332ccf5a36f96c45af2028ce81ea825fd Mon Sep 17 00:00:00 2001
From: Satyajit Sahoo <satyajit.happy@gmail.com>
Date: Wed, 27 Feb 2013 20:59:38 +0530
Subject: [PATCH] Adjusted more colors

---
 gtk-3.0/apps/gnome-applications.css | 67 +++++++++++++----------------
 gtk-3.0/apps/unity.css              | 14 +++---
 2 files changed, 38 insertions(+), 43 deletions(-)

diff --git a/gtk-3.0/apps/gnome-applications.css b/gtk-3.0/apps/gnome-applications.css
index 0644ba6..a78ce47 100644
--- a/gtk-3.0/apps/gnome-applications.css
+++ b/gtk-3.0/apps/gnome-applications.css
@@ -5,10 +5,8 @@ PanelWidget,
 PanelApplet,
 PanelToplevel {
     padding: 0;
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(@panel_bg_color, 1.1)),
-                                     to (shade(@panel_bg_color, 0.9)));
-
+    background-image: none;
+    background-color: @panel_bg_color;
     color: @panel_fg_color;
 }
 
@@ -18,32 +16,28 @@ PanelApplet {
 
 PanelSeparator {
     border-width: 0;
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(@panel_bg_color, 1.1)),
-                                     to (shade(@panel_bg_color, 0.9)));
-
+    background-image: none;
+    background-color: @panel_bg_color;
     color: @panel_fg_color;
 }
 
 .gnome-panel-menu-bar,
-PanelApplet > GtkMenuBar.menubar,
-PanelApplet > GtkMenuBar.menubar.menuitem,
-PanelMenuBar.menubar,
-PanelMenuBar.menubar.menuitem {
-    -PanelMenuBar-icon-visible: true;
+PanelApplet > Gtkpanel.panel,
+PanelApplet > Gtkpanel.panel.menuitem,
+Panelpanel.panel,
+Panelpanel.panel.menuitem {
+    -Panelpanel-icon-visible: true;
 
     border-width: 0;
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(@panel_bg_color, 1.1)),
-                                     to (shade(@panel_bg_color, 0.9)));
+    background-image: none;
+    background-color: @panel_bg_color;
 }
 
 PanelAppletFrame {
     border-width: 0;
-    background-color: @panel_bg_color; 
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(@panel_bg_color, 1.1)),
-                                     to (shade(@panel_bg_color, 0.9)));
+    background-color: @panel_bg_color;
+    background-image: none;
+    background-color: @panel_bg_color;
 }
 
 PanelApplet .button {
@@ -52,34 +46,35 @@ PanelApplet .button {
     border-width: 0 1px;
     border-radius: 0;
     border-color: transparent;
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(@panel_bg_color, 1.1)),
-                                     to (shade(@panel_bg_color, 0.9)));
-
+    background-image: none;
+    background-color: @panel_bg_color;
     color: @panel_fg_color;
 }
 
 PanelApplet .button:active {
     border-width: 0 1px;
     border-radius: 0;
-    border-color: shade(@panel_bg_color, 0.8);
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(shade(@panel_bg_color, 1.02), 0.9)),
-                                     to (shade(shade(@panel_bg_color, 1.02), 0.95)));
+    border-color: mix(@panel_bg_color, @theme_bg_color, 0.23);
+    border-color: mix(@panel_bg_color, @theme_bg_color, 0.23);
+    background-image: none;
+    background-color: mix(@panel_bg_color, @theme_bg_color, 0.21);
+    color: mix(@panel_fg_color, @theme_base_color, 0.8);
 }
 
 PanelApplet .button:prelight {
     border-color: transparent;
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(@panel_bg_color, 1.2)),
-                                     to (shade(@panel_bg_color, 1.0)));
+    border-color: mix(@panel_bg_color, @theme_bg_color, 0.13);
+    background-image: none;
+    background-color: mix(@panel_bg_color, @theme_bg_color, 0.11);
+    color: mix(@panel_fg_color, @theme_base_color, 0.8);
 }
 
 PanelApplet .button:active:prelight {
-    border-color: shade(@panel_bg_color, 0.8);
-    background-image: -gtk-gradient(linear, left top, left bottom,
-                                     from (shade(shade(@panel_bg_color, 1.02), 1.0)),
-                                     to (shade(shade(@panel_bg_color, 1.02), 1.05)));
+    border-color: mix(@panel_bg_color, @theme_bg_color, 0.33);
+    border-color: mix(@panel_bg_color, @theme_bg_color, 0.33);
+    background-image: none;
+    background-color: mix(@panel_bg_color, @theme_bg_color, 0.31);
+    color: mix(@panel_fg_color, @theme_base_color, 0.8);
 }
 
 WnckPager, WnckTasklist {
@@ -184,7 +179,7 @@ TerminalScreen {
     -TerminalScreen-background-darkness: 0.9;
 
     background-color: @menubar_bg_color;
-    color: #eee;
+    color: @menubar_fg_color;
 }
 
 TerminalWindow GtkNotebook.notebook {
diff --git a/gtk-3.0/apps/unity.css b/gtk-3.0/apps/unity.css
index feb8384..47a9346 100644
--- a/gtk-3.0/apps/unity.css
+++ b/gtk-3.0/apps/unity.css
@@ -8,8 +8,8 @@ UnityPanelWidget,
     color: @panel_fg_color;
 }
 
-.unity-panel.menubar,
-.unity-panel .menubar {
+.unity-panel.panel,
+.unity-panel .panel {
 }
 
 .unity-panel.menuitem,
@@ -18,10 +18,10 @@ UnityPanelWidget,
     color: @panel_fg_color;
 }
 
-.unity-panel.menubar.menuitem:hover,
-.unity-panel.menubar .menuitem *:hover {
-    border-color: mix(@menubar_bg_color, @theme_bg_color, 0.23);
+.unity-panel.panel.menuitem:hover,
+.unity-panel.panel .menuitem *:hover {
+    border-color: mix(@panel_bg_color, @theme_bg_color, 0.23);
     background-image: none;
-    background-color: mix(@menubar_bg_color, @theme_bg_color, 0.21);
-    color: mix(@menubar_fg_color, @theme_base_color, 0.8);
+    background-color: mix(@panel_bg_color, @theme_bg_color, 0.21);
+    color: mix(@panel_fg_color, @theme_base_color, 0.8);
 }